Madame de Stael, born Anne Louise Germaine Necker, was a prominent French writer and intellectual figure of the 18th and 19th centuries. She was known for her sharp wit, political activism, and literary contributions. Throughout her life, Madame de Stael lived a noble life that was dedicated to the pursuit of knowledge, freedom, and justice. Her intellectual curiosity and passion for literature and politics set her apart from her contemporaries, and she was revered as one of the leading intellectuals of her time.

As Madame de Stael grew older, her influence only seemed to grow stronger. She continued to write prolifically, engaging in political debates and advocating for social change. Her works, such as "On Literature" and "Germany," were groundbreaking in their exploration of literature, philosophy, and politics. Madame de Stael's commitment to intellectual pursuits and her unwavering dedication to her beliefs made her a formidable force in the intellectual and political circles of her time.
